简略点说,便是把你写好代码(C或者是汇编)特地的机器语言经过必定的方法下载到单片机中。称为烧写。
烧写软件许多,方法也许多,首要看你的单片机类型.
STC系列单片机为例: 首要,需求装置keil软件和STC_ISP程序下载软件。 先对你想要完结对单片机的功能用keil编程,然后用STC_ISP下载软件下载到单片机上,终究翻开给单片机供给电源就能够调查单片机开发板或是自己建立的板子上的现象了…经过不断修正程序,下载程序,终究取得自己在试验板上想要的成果。这样就能够了… 试验板与PC机的衔接:一般对现成购买的开发板来说,会有一个USB接口供给5v电源、供给通讯或另一个USB用来下载接口驱动程序,一起有RS232串口,完结MAX232电平与单片机TTL电平之间转化,用来进行通讯下载程序和数据;;对自己建立的电路板来说,仍会有MAX232芯片和RS232串口用来完结程序的烧写,完结对单片机写入数据和程序的下载。用的是RS232串口完结的程序烧写! 若要用USB来烧写,需求一个相应的ISP下载软件和硬件烧写器,一般这种烧写器价格不菲。用的是USB口完结烧写程序! 一般的,烧写程序仍是选用能够用ISP下载的,自己建立个RS232串口的电路,简略有用,对单片机烧写程序就够用了。
进程:
1.首要翻开Easy 51Pro应用程序;
2.挑选单片机类型“AT89S51”,并调查软件右边“状况”信息;
3.别忘了挑选驱动,不然会呈现“编程器:没有检测到器材(特征字:ff fff ff)”信息,驱动设置如图:
4.之后回到“状况”信息栏,并点“检测器材”,假如按进程一步一步操作,会看到“编程器:检测到器材(特征字……)”等状况信息;
5.信息表明编程器现已检测到器材,下面就翻开现已编译好的.hex文件,如图:
6.屏住呼吸,要开端对单片机进行烧写拉。。。
点“主动完结”,状况信息显现相似如图右边信息之后,点“写锁定位”即完结单片机烧写进程。
详细的烧写软件能够上网上查找,一般都有的。